
Goliath Heron
A true giant of a bird standing just short of 1.5m (nearly as tall as the wife) the bill is the size of a large carving knife. I really wanted a shot with something else in to give perspective to its size but the mangrove leaves behind are approx 75-100mm long.
The Goliath Heron , also known as the Giant Heron, is a very large wading bird of the heron family Ardeidae. It is found in sub-Saharan Africa, with smaller numbers in Southwest and South Asia.
